BENTON – An Elizabethtown woman is in the Franklin County Jail on meth-related charges.
Franklin County Sheriff Kyle Bacon says around 12:20 Wednesday morning, a deputy stopped a vehicle 31-year-old Adawnya D. Solomon was a passenger in on North Main Street near McFall Street in Benton.
After initial contact, the deputy requested a K9 respond to conduct a free air sniff of the vehicle. A sheriff’s office K9 unit responded. A positive alert was made and a search was conducted. Four clear plastic bags of a white crystalline substance were located on Solomon.
Deputies field tested the bags which showed positive for the presence of methamphetamine. Solomon was taken to the Franklin County Jail.
Solomon is charged with Unlawful Possession with the Intent to Deliver Methamphetamine (15 to 100 grams) and Unlawful Possession of Methamphetamine (15 to 100 grams).
Deputies were assisted by officers from the Benton Police Department.
